What are the most common Mercedes-Benz repair issues for drivers in the Glenallen area?

Given the r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, common issues include suspension component wear (like control arms and air struts), electrical glitches from moisture, and problems with the AdBlue system in diesel models. Regular undercarriage inspections are advised due to gravel road driving.

How do I know if a local Glenallen shop is qualified to work on my Mercedes-Benz?

Look for shops that advertise specific European or Mercedes-Benz training, have direct experience with Mercedes diagnostic systems (like STAR), and use OEM or high-quality parts. In a smaller community, asking for referrals from other local Mercedes owners is very effective.

When should I seek local service versus going to the nearest Mercedes-Benz dealership?

For routine maintenance, oil services, brakes, and tire work, a qualified local independent shop in Glenallen can be convenient and cost-effective. For complex computer updates, advanced driver-assistance system calibrations, or warranty work, the nearest dealerships in Cape Girardeau or Paducah may be necessary.

Are there any local driving conditions in Glenallen that affect my Mercedes-Benz service schedule?

Yes. Dust from gravel roads can clog air filters and get into brakes more quickly. Also, the use of road salt in winter can accelerate corrosion. It's wise to have more frequent cabin air filter changes and undercarriage washes or inspections to combat these local factors.
